selfless

English

Etymology

self +? -less

Pronunciation

Adjective

selfless (comparative more selfless, superlative most selfless)

  1. Having, exhibiting or motivated by no concern for oneself but for others; unselfish.
    In a selfless act of gratitude for saving his mother's life, Peter committed to giving money to his local breast cancer charity each year for the rest of his life.

Derived terms

  • selflessly
  • selflessness

altruist

English

Etymology

See altruism.

Noun

altruist (plural altruists)

  1. A person showing altruism.
    This event couldn't have been possible without the efforts of the altruists who helped in their spare time.

Synonyms

  • philanthropist

Antonyms

  • egoist

Related terms

  • altruism
  • altruistic
